You can still get gas under $5 a gallon in the Sacramento area: Here’s where to look
Gas prices are skyrocketing all over the country right now, and gas stations in Sacramento are no exception to the trend. In fact, gas prices in California are among the highest in the country.
According to statistics from the American Automobile Association, national average regular gas prices reached an all-time high at around $4.17 per gallon today, breaking records from the 2008 crisis.
In California, the average price for a regular gallon of gas is $5.44, up 10 cents from Monday. The Sacramento metro is averaging $5.39 per gallon.
